What do you all think is a good bedtime snack, for when you wake up and just need something =)

Something with protein if you're not vegan - milk, yogurt, cheese. It'll help you go back to sleep, whereas a sweet treat will likely keep you awake. I also liked bananas when I was pregnant, or toast with butter or a nut butter (w/o hydrogenated fat though!).
